Yehliu Geopark, one of Taiwan's most unique natural attractions. Walk along the dramatic coastline and discover fascinating rock formations shaped by wind and sea, including the world-famous Queen's Head.
Enjoy the stunning contrast of blue and golden water caused by natural mineral deposits from old mining sites. This unique coastal landscape is one of northern Taiwan’s most famous photo spots.
Admire this picturesque waterfall cascading down the golden-hued rocks near Jinguashi. The colors are created by mineral-rich water from the nearby mountains.
Discover Taiwan’s mining heritage at the Gold Museum. Walk through historical buildings, learn how gold was extracted, and enjoy panoramic views of the mountains and sea.
Wander through the narrow alleyways of Jiufen Old Street, filled with red lanterns, teahouses, and local snacks such as taro balls and fish balls. Enjoy lunch with a view over the mountain town and the Pacific Ocean.
Walk along the suspension bridge and forest path to Taiwan’s widest waterfall, often called the “Niagara of Taiwan.” Enjoy the refreshing mist and take memorable photos of this breathtaking natural wonder.
Stroll along the railway street lined with shops and cafes. Write your wishes on a colorful sky lantern and release it into the sky for good luck — a beloved local tradition.
